BBA in Aviation After 12th

BBA in Aviation after 12th is a 3-year undergraduate programme. The BBA Aviation course is designed to provide essential training to lead teams and manage them with tasks of Air transportation, operations, Passenger forecasting, marketing, Airport Planning etc. Admission to the BBA Aviation course is being offered by Lovely Professional University, Jagannath University through an entrance test.

Eligibility criteria for the course are applicant must have passed class 12th from a recognized board with a minimum aggregate of 50%. The annual fee for the BBA Aviation course after 12th ranges between INR 70,000 to INR 4,00,000. After completing the course a graduate can earn an initial salary of INR 4-8 LPA.

Air Hostess Job Responsibilities

After completing the Air Hostess Courses after 12th, the candidates can find work in various airlines and airports. The main task of candidates in their job profiles is to look after the facilities for passengers. This is to make sure that the passengers do not get any kind of trouble during their journey. At the time of the job, they are expected to ensure that every possible need of the passenger is completed, and they also play an important role in the safe conduct of the flights.

Candidates who want to make a career as an air hostess must be prepared for this course within the time. Applicants can enroll in a certificate or a diploma course after 12th. After that candidates can get involved in training programmes that are listed below:

  • The candidates will get the required training to handle the flight's passengers.
  • They will be taught to handle every emergency easily to avoid any panic during the flight.
  • The candidates will get to increase their skills in presenting themselves.
  • They will then be taught about the group discussion round. In the GD, they will get to increase their leadership skills and communication skills which play an essential role in the job of the cabin crew.
  • After the GD round, there is an interview round for which the candidates are prepared to increase their skills for communicating with people.

The candidates who clear all the training programs learn about the emergency landing procedures and how to deal with emergency services.

Air Hostess Course after 12th Age Limit

A basic requirement for becoming an air hostess is the candidate should pass 10+2 in the stream from an authorized board. minimum age limit is 17 years and the upper age limit is 26 years for air hostesses.

How to Become an Airhostess? 

Students who want to start their journey as an Airhostess need to complete their class 12th and study Diploma/certification courses or Undergraduate degree. Student age should be 17-26 years at least 5 feet 2 inches in height, and unmarried. If students wear glasses, their vision should be correctable 6/6. To become an air hostess you need to be medically fit and have a good personality. 

To start a journey, you can apply to training institutes or airlines. First, you need to pass an entrance exam. After that, there will be a main interview focusing on your voice, communication skills, and personality. If you crack it, the airline will provide a six-month air hostess training program.

Career Opportunities in Air Hostess Courses after 12th

After the successful compilation of the Air Hostess course after 12th, the candidates are granted many opportunities to make their career a big hit. Most of the candidates easily get campus placement, and some who are left can apply to various industries and get a suitable job. Many recruiters offer admission to candidates as the campus placement; some are SpiceJet, Air India, Vistara, etc.

The candidates will mostly get placed in the industry as a trainee for the first few months, but after they complete their training program, they will get rewarded with a good job profile. 

Students can get an Air Hostess job for At least 10-12 years. Then, they can work as Ground Hostess,  Guest Relationship officers and Trainers for Junior Air Hostesses in many private institutes and airlines.

Salary After Air Hostess Courses after 12th

The average salary package that a candidate gets after completing the Air Hostess course after 12th is relatively higher, but there are also many benefits that a candidate gets after completing these courses.

There are a lot of perks and benefits to working as an air hostess. They are rewarded with good prizes and gifts, and the airline provides health benefits like medical insurance, and free travel benefits apart from their good salary packages. It would be different according to airlines. 

The average salary package that a candidate gets in their first job is generally between 3 lakh to 5 lakh. Still, the salary increases gradually as their experience and skills get increase.
